casestatus.in Summary

Case Summary In this Special Leave Petition (Criminal) heard on 02-04-2026, petitioner Prem Chand Shandil @ Santosh Jha sought exemption from surrendering within time. Justice Alok Aradhe rejected the exemption plea but granted six weeks' time for the petitioner to surrender and produce a surrender certificate before the court.
